Postdoctoral Fellow-Lung Cancer Genetics

MD Anderson

Houston, TX 77030


Description

A co-mentored postdoctoral fellow position is available in the Department of Genetics and Thoracic Oncology under the direct supervision of both Dr. Vaishnavi and Dr. Gardner. Our research focuses on studying the molecular and biological processes governing the development and plasticity of cancer, histological transformation, the basis for environmental exposures and the development of cancer and improving the therapeutic responses for lung cancer. We are working towards producing translational discoveries leading to better methods of early cancer detection, improved cancer patient care and new cancer drug development. The range of our research includes cancer drug and biomarker development, cancer gene discovery, lung biology and development of novel genetically engineered or variations of mouse models to study human cancers.

LEARNING OBJECTIVES
Qualified individuals will demonstrate the potential for research as evidenced by their peer-reviewed publications and funding. They will have a background in cancer biology and expertise in the design of experiments and the execution of in vitro and in vivo experiments, as well as demonstrating expertise in molecular biology, genetics, cell culture, and all aspects of animal work, etc.

ELIGIBILITY REQUIREMENTS
Applicants must have a recent Ph.D. degree with strong research interests.
